Understanding Scars and Their Impact
Scars form when the skin undergoes trauma and repairs itself. During this healing process, excess collagen is produced, which may lead to raised scars (hypertrophic or keloid) or depressed scars (atrophic), such as those caused by acne. Scars may also appear darker or lighter than the surrounding skin, creating unevenness in tone.

What Are Chemical Peels?
Chemical peels are dermatological treatments that involve applying a chemical solution to the skin, which exfoliates damaged layers and encourages the growth of healthier skin. Depending on the strength and depth of the peel, this treatment can target superficial, medium, or deep skin concerns, including scars.
Types of chemical peels include:
-
Superficial Peels: Mild peels using alpha-hydroxy acids (AHAs) like glycolic acid to treat light scars and improve texture.
-
Medium Peels: Use trichloroacetic acid (TCA) to target deeper scars and uneven pigmentation.
-
Deep Peels: Employ stronger acids such as phenol, designed for significant scarring but requiring longer downtime.
How Chemical Peels Work for Scar Reduction
1. Exfoliation of Damaged Layers
Scars often appear rough and uneven due to damaged skin layers. Chemical peels gently remove these outer layers, exposing fresh, smoother skin underneath.
2. Stimulating Collagen Production
Medium and deep chemical peels trigger collagen remodeling in the skin. This helps fill in depressed scars, making them less noticeable over time.
3. Evening Out Skin Tone
Scars often leave behind discoloration or hyperpigmentation. Chemical peels lighten these dark marks and blend them with the surrounding skin for a more uniform tone.
4. Refining Skin Texture
By removing dead cells and encouraging skin renewal, chemical peels smooth out rough patches and improve overall skin texture, reducing the visible impact of scars.
5. Treating Acne Scars Specifically
For individuals dealing with acne scars, chemical peels reduce post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ation and soften shallow indentations, leading to clearer, more even skin.

Who Is a Good Candidate?
Chemical peels are effective for many people, but the ideal candidates include:
-
Individuals with acne scars, mild to moderate surgical scars, or pigmentation scars.
-
Those with realistic expectations understand that scars may be reduced but not completely erased.
-
Patients with fair to medium skin tones, as deeper peels may pose higher risks for darker complexions.
-
People are willing to follow aftercare instructions to protect their renewed skin.
A dermatologist consultation is essential to assess skin type, scar depth, and the appropriate peel.
What to Expect During the Procedure
-
Consultation and Assessment: The dermatologist evaluates the scars and chooses the right peel type.
-
Preparation: The skin is cleansed to remove impurities.
-
Application: The chemical solution is applied and left for a few minutes, depending on its strength.
-
Neutralization: The peel is neutralized, and soothing products are applied.
-
Post-Treatment: Patients may experience redness, peeling, or mild irritation for a few days.
Most people resume normal activities soon after superficial peels, while medium or deep peels may require some downtime.
Aftercare Tips for Best Results
-
Apply dermatologist-recommended moisturizers and sunscreens daily.
-
Avoid scratching or peeling off flaking skin to prevent scarring.
-
Stay out of direct sunlight and avoid tanning for at least a few weeks.
-
Refrain from using harsh scrubs or retinoids until skin fully recovers.
-
Follow the dermatologist’s advice for follow-up treatments.
